Westminster Christian Fellowship Buzzcard Access Control System Benjamin Davis Nathan Firesheets Mark Whitmer May 3, 2010 School of Electrical and Computer Engineering Georgia Institute of Technology

Project Overview Upgraded existing WCF access control system to include RFID support and a web interface, and comply with life safety codes Cost $850 to control Dining Room door

Design Objectives TaskAccomplished? Add RFID card readersYes Retain existing magnetic stripe card readerYes Upgrade door hardware to meet codeYes Implement secure web administration interfaceYes Maintain secure access log offsiteYes

Old System Single door Magnetic stripe card reader Magnetic lock RS-232 terminal administration

New System (Interior) Installed Electric Strike Lock: Electric Strike Mounts Here Panic Bar Mounts Here Proposed Crash Bar & Strike:

New System (Exterior) RFID Card Reader Mounts Here Door Pull Handle Mounts Here Proposed RFID Reader & Pull Handle: Existing Magnetic Stripe Card Reader Installed Pull Handle and RFID Reader:

Control System Functional Diagram The Web Administrator eBox Single Board Computer (Authorized Card Database) PIC Microcontroller Board (Door Hardware Electrical Interface) Optical Isolation Readers Strike Solid State Relay

SBC Software Functional Diagram MySQL Database Web Server The Web Serial Bridge Process To PIC RS-232 ODBC

Web Interface Functionality Administrators: ▫User management – create, remove, change ▫Card authorization – add and remove cards from users ▫Log review ▫Lock/unlock event scheduling Other user privileges (assignable to individual users) ▫Change own password for web interface ▫Building access via web (iPhone, laptop) ▫Lock/unlock doors (dogging/“double-tap”)

Actual Design Cost ComponentCost PIC microcontroller$5 eBox single board computer (SBC)$200 RFID Reader$25 Electric strike lock$355 Panic bar$110 Misc. Hardware Components$100 Misc. Electronic Components$55 Labor$0 Total Cost$850 Proposed Cost-$800 Over Budget$50

Current Progress Crash bar, surface-mount strike, RFID readers installed and fully operational PIC board receives card info from magnetic stripe and RFID readers and outputs to SBC SBC running appropriate software Web interface user management and door control complete SBC outputs commands to PIC board, which locks and unlocks electric strike

Acceptance Testing TestProposedMeasured False negative card scans<3%<1% False positive card scans0% Unauthorized web access0% Web interface door open<5 seconds<2 seconds Card reader door open<5 seconds<2 seconds Activation of credentials effective100% Deactivation of credentials effective100%

System Transition Plan Existing system still fully operational and connected to magnetic card reader New system connected to RFID reader Add users to new database Take existing system offline, remove existing hardware from system enclosure Install new hardware in system enclosure Connect magnetic card reader to new system Bring new system online

Schedule Project demonstration – May 3 Transition from old system to new – May 6 New system fully operational – May 7
